Falcone–Borsellino Airport (PMO) is approximately 30 km from Stella Maris Casa Vacanze in Palermo. Travel time can vary with traffic, so it’s smart to plan buffer time for arrival and departure.
The nearest major stations listed are Palermo Notarbartolo Railway Station at about 4 km and Palermo Centrale Railway Station at roughly 6 km. These can be useful for day trips and for getting around the city with less reliance on taxis.
